On this episode of Gloria’s Gab Live, Gloria Burns sits down with Jeneissy Azcuy, Chief of Marketing & Education at South Florida PBS, to talk about the exciting immersive experiences and new membership opportunities now being offered through South Florida PBS.
They discuss the highly anticipated Titanic: An Immersive Voyage, a multisensory exhibition featuring artifacts, room recreations, immersive storytelling, and even a virtual reality dive to the Titanic wreck site, now hosted at WXEL South Florida PBS in Boynton Beach. They also highlight Egyptian Pharaohs: From Cheops to Ramses II, an immersive journey through ancient Egypt created with leading Egyptologists and stunning 3D reconstructions. South Florida PBS is also introducing its new Immersive Membership, expanding access to educational, cultural, and family-friendly programming and experiences.
This conversation explores how South Florida PBS continues to lead in educational storytelling, cultural engagement, and innovative community programming across South Florida.
